Squeaky Brakes

Has anyone had problems with their brakes. My M5 has 5,000 miles on it and the brakes started to squeak quite bad this past month. Grip and stopping is fine. This is my 6th M car and first to have an issue with the brakes. I have an appointment next week to have them looked at.

Had some squeaking from my brakes. Just go do a few hard stops from 80 or so and it should clean up the rotors a bit.

I posted about this when I first got my car a few months ago and no one seemed concerned at the time. I posted because I don't care for the brake dust and the squeal.

I solved both on my 08 M5 when I went to a low dust pad made by Carbo-Tech (ex-racers and definitely know the problem). Recently went to these on my wife's SRT Grand Cherokee which has the same dust problem. Greatly reduced the dust.
